We provide WorkCover medical assessments, issue Certificates of Capacity, and coordinate your treatment plan — all at no cost to you. WorkCover is simply the NSW name for workers compensation, and your medical treatment, time-off wages and rehabilitation are covered in full under the scheme.
Beacon Hill sits above the Wakehurst Parkway near the Northern Beaches Hospital precinct, with the working population concentrated in healthcare, retail, education and the construction trades servicing the surrounding suburbs. Workers compensation files at Beacon Hill cover ward-nurse manual transfers, aged-care personal-handling injuries from local facilities, retail slip-and-stocking complaints, and the ladder-and-roof footing slips that catch local renovators.

Common Work Injuries in Beacon Hill
Beacon Hill's workforce leans on Healthcare, Retail, Education and Construction. The work injuries our team treats and documents most often here:
- Psychological injury and burnout Trauma exposure, aggression, shift burnout and workplace bullying.
- Back injury from manual handling Patient repositioning, lifting and transfers.
- Shoulder injury Repetitive patient-handling and transfer loads.
- Wrist and hand RSI Clinical notes, IV lines, repetitive task load.
- Foot and ankle injuries Long shifts, wet floors and corridor slips between wards.
- Neck injuries from patient handling Awkward lifts, transfers and prolonged bedside work.
